A street in New York in the USA is named after the national hero, Gjergj Kastriot Skënderbeu.

The Albanian American community organized a ceremony with Albanian music and flags to inaugurate the new street in New York. New York Mayor Eric Adams and Erion Veliaj also joined the ceremony. The celebrations in the Bronx, in a part of the city, which is now known as “Little Albania”, aroused the interest of Americans. The new name at the intersection of Crescent Avenue and Adams Place was approved earlier this year by New York City, at the request of former city council member and Albanian-American activist Mark Gjonaj.
